Lowrance provides greater detail and coverage with C-MAP Contour+ Charts

by Andrew Golden 7 May 2020 14:34 AEST
New C-MAP contourplus © Andrew Golden

Lowrance®, a world-leader in fishing electronics since 1957, announced today CMAP Contour+ charts will be preloaded on all Lowrance HDS LIVE displays shipping in June. The new high-resolution mapping features performance improvements, more detail and greater lake coverage than the popular C-MAP US Enhanced map previously included with HDS LIVE. Current HDS LIVE owners will have option to purchase an HDS LIVE C-MAP Contour+ chart card for a nominal fee. Additionally, customers who purchase an HDS LIVE display between April 1, 2020 and August 1, 2020 are eligible to receive a free C-MAP Contour+ map card via online rebate.

Covering inland and near-shore coastal areas of the continental U.S., plus Hawaii and Bermuda, C-MAP Contour+ charts feature high-res bathymetric 1-foot contours, fishing points of interest (POIs), standard navigation data and updated custom depth shading. In an improvement over previous preloaded C-MAP charts, the new cartography includes a more consistent presentation of data through all zoom levels, improved icons for POIs on land and water - such as improved boat ramps and gas stations - as well as building foundations, submerged roadbeds and channel lines, which are redrawn in a new color for greater visibility.

The new Contour+ charts include expanded coverage on 10,000 U.S. lakes and 8,900 lakes with 1-foot contours - more than twice the number included in the previous C-MAP US Enhanced embedded chart.
